Certificate error on web site.

This is basically an Internet Explorer 7 Website’s Security Certificate problem! You have to self-sign the certificate on the client computer or add the URL manually to the trusted security zone. When you are trying to access a secure web page, you receive the warning message:

"There is a problem with this website's security certificate. The security certificate presented by this website was not issued by a trusted certificate authority."

Or

"Security certificate problems may indicate an attempt to fool you or intercept data you send to the server."

To fix this issue, you can follow either of the methods:

meth1.jpg
meth2.jpg
ie%281%29.jpg

Method 1:

You have to install the Microsoft Windows Small Business Server 2003 (Windows SBS) self-signed certificate on the client computer. To do this, follow these steps:

  • In Windows Internet Explorer 7, click Continue to this website (not recommended).
A red Address Bar and a certificate warning appear.
  • Click Certificate Error button to open the information window.
  • Click View Certificates > click Install Certificate.
  • Click Yes, to install the certificate, when warning message appear.

Note: For Windows Vista users, right click on Internet Explorer icon. Select Run as Administrator.

Method 2:

Add the URL to the Trusted Sites security zone:

  • Open Internet Explorer
  • Go to Menu bar > Tools > Internet Options.

    tool.jpg
  • Click Security > Trusted sites > Sites

    sec.jpg
  • Type the URL in the Add this website to the zone text box > uncheck Require server verification >Add > click OK

    trust.jpg
  • Click OK to exit.

    cus.jpg

Now you have added the URL successfully into the Trusted Sites security zone.

Revocation message in Outlook Express

Outlook express has a setting to check for certificate revocation.
Drop down the Tools menu and choose Options.
Click on the security tab and on the Advanced button.

You should see a section towards the bottom of the dialog box named Certificate Revocation.

I have never changed these settings and mine is set to Never.

If yours isn't set to never give it a try and see what happens.

Digital Certificates are used for encryption and authentication.

Revocation is used when a Certification Authority issues a certificate to a company or individual and then something happens that makes the Authority cancel the certificate. There are many reasons why and I'm not going to speculate.

Have a look in your case who issued the certificate and who it is issued to. It could be someone up to no good and you would be better off to figure out what is going on before you just turn it off.

Server certificate

When an SSL certificate is created, the address that will be used to connect to the web page is specified. (www.mywebpage.com) If you are connecting to the IP address of the website, it will tell you that the addres that you have gone to, and the site on teh certificate don't match. There are also some problems with forwarding domain names improperly. what address are you trying to go to, and what exactly does the error say?
